The latest official matchday programme for the 2025/26 season in now on sale as Wolves face Burnley at Molineux this Sunday.
Santi Bueno is the cover star of Sunday's programme, as the defender features not only on the front, but also inside the latest edition - which can be purchased for just £4 - as the Uruguayan provides the main feature interview.
The Burnley edition features an extended interview with the defender, who recently captained his country to victory as he donned the armband for the first time in the friendly win over Uzbekistan a fortnight ago.
Also inside this weekend's programme are comments from head coach Vitor Pereira as well as Hugo Bueno and Matt Doherty, while the new first-team player features come from David Moller Wolfe, who gives supporters a look 'Inside the Changing Room', while Jose Sa takes readers 'All Around the World'.
As well as a Black History Month feature with Marshall Munetsi, there is also a packed history section, while the away section includes an array of features focusing on this weekend's visitors from Lancashire.
There is also focus on the other areas of the club, as women's first-team midfielder Abi Loydon shares her Matchday Diary, there's the latest from Wolves Academy, the Foundation and we take a step back into the Old Gold past with Wolves Museum.
All this and much more, including a look at the best Wolves/Burnley moments from history and a preview of what the visitors are expected to bring to Molineux, is all available in the official matchday programme.
